Enforcement of Foreign Courts Decrees
According to International Private and Procedural Law, enforcement of court decrees rendered by foreign courts in the course of civil lawsuits in Turkey which are final pursuant to the law of that foreign state shall be subject to the enforcement decision of the competent Turkish court.
Thus we must file an enforcement lawsuit against the debtor in Turkey upon service of the original foreign court decree on parties (both the Plaintiff and the Defendant). Upon the enforcement decision of the Turkish competent court, we can commence execution proceedings before the competent enforcement office to collect the amount of debt.
The Courts of First Instance shall have jurisdiction over enforcement decisions. These decisions shall be requested from the court at the place of habitual residence of the person against whom enforcement is requested if he/she does have a domicile in Turkey, or from one of the courts in Istanbul, Ankara, or Izmir if he/she does not have a domicile or habitual residence in Turkey.
Nevertheless, there is no unity in practice, because some civil courts of the first instance reject the applications owing to lack of jurisdiction and send the file to the relevant commercial, intellectual property, or labor courts.
